首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有下列程序: #include<stdio.h> main() { char v[5][10]={”efg”,”abcd”,”snopq”,”hijkl”,”xyz”}; printf(”%s,%c
有下列程序: #include<stdio.h> main() { char v[5][10]={”efg”,”abcd”,”snopq”,”hijkl”,”xyz”}; printf(”%s,%c
admin
2022-10-25
43
问题
有下列程序:
#include<stdio.h>
main()
{
char v[5][10]={”efg”,”abcd”,”snopq”,”hijkl”,”xyz”};
printf(”%s,%c,%s,%c,%s”,*v,**(v+3),v[4]+2,*(v[2]+4),v[1]+1);
}
程序执行后的输出结果是( )。
选项
A、efg,h,z,q,bcd
B、efg,d,zyz,w,bbcd
C、efgabcdsnopqhijklxyz,h,z,q,bcd
D、efgabcdsnopqhijklxyz,d,zyz,w,bbcd
答案
A
解析
程序定义一个二维字符数组v,使用5个字符串对其初始化。表达式“*v”等价于“*(v+0)”,输出的是数组v的第1个元素efg;“**(v+3)”等价于“*(*(v+3)+0)”,输出的是数组v的第4个元素的第1个字符h;“v[4]”表示数组v的第5个元素,“v[4]+2”表示输出从下标2开始的所有字符,即z;“v[2]”表示数组v的第3个元素,“*(v[2]+4)”表示数组v的第3个元素的下标为4的字符,即q;“v[1]+1”表示数组v的第2个元素从下标1开始的子字符串,即bcd。所以程序输出:efg,h,z,q,bcd。本题答案为A选项。
转载请注明原文地址:https://jikaoti.com/ti/wGd0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若有函数定义如下:intfun(intx,inty){returnx-y;}则以下涉及上述函数的说明语句错误的()。
在C语言中,以下说法不正确的是()。
构成计算机软件的是
以下选项中,合法的C语言常量是()。
两个或两个以上模块之间关联的紧密程度称为
设树T的深度为4,其中度为1,2,3,4的结点个数分别为4,2,1,1。则T中的叶子结点数为
若有如下说明,且int类型占两个字节,则正确的叙述为()。structstfinta;intb[2];}a;
下列选项中不属于软件生命周期开发阶段任务的是()。
软件生存周期中,解决软件“做什么”的阶段是()。
实现运行时的多态性要使用()。
随机试题
单相桥式整流电路负载上得到的直流平均电流比单相半波整流提高了()倍。
如果某商品的价格上涨10%,其产量增加2%,则该商品的价格弹性系数为()
患者,女,48岁。症见左侧腰腹绞痛,痛引少腹,尿中夹有血块,尿频、尿急,舌暗红,脉细涩。治疗宜
脑出血的确诊依据是
慢性胃炎患者,有明显胆汁反流,治疗上最好使用
对液压、弹簧和气压操动机构等的合闸电流,一般怎样取值?
采用预裂爆破法施工隧道时,其分区起爆顺序为()。
某项目的设备及工器具购置费2000万元,建筑安装工程费800万元,工程建设其他费200万元,基本预备费费率5%,则该项目的基本预备费为()万元。
商店里的货品有标价,如一支钢笔标价为6元。在这里,货币执行的是()的职能。
Whatisthemaintopicofthisconversation?
最新回复
(
0
)